Sugar Cookies for Hamentashen or Other Shapes (GF) Recipe

Ingredients: 6 oz. safflower oil (or other vegetable oil) ¾ cup sugar 1 tsp. vanilla extract 2 eggs 4 tsp. milk (you can substitute rice milk, soy milk or almond milk) 1 ¾ cups sweet rice flour, or 2 cups Featherlight® Flour Blend (I recommend Authentic Foods® brand for both flours) 1 ½ tsp. baking powder ¼ tsp. salt ¼ tsp. baking soda 2 tsp. xanthan gum jam or other filling for Hamentashen

Directions:Thoroughly mix oil, sugar and vanilla. Add eggs; beat until light and fluffy. Stir in milk. Sift together dry ingredients. Blend into creamed mixture (using a hands-free electric mixer works best). Divide dough into four balls. Chill at least half an hour. Preheat oven to 375⁰. Roll out dough to 1/8” thick. Cut in shapes. Bake 6 - 10 minutes (time varies based on size and thickness of cookies). For Hamentashen: Use a circle-shaped cookie cutter or the top of a drinking glass to cut out the cookies from the dough. Fill the middle of the circle with jam or other filling and tightly pinch three corners to form a triangle with the filling in the middle. If you don't pinch it tightly enough, the circle will open and the jam will spread when you bake. |
